Its not that kind of thing. Their ZT2 file works with zip but these are files inside that. Apparently even the modders of ZT2 could not solve this so there are a few prehistoric animals that they just cannot mod. There was a bonus pack called "Dino Danger Pack" which was released before the main prehistoric themed expansion pack. It had 4 dinosaurs but no ice age megafauna. Thus they were able to extract things like T-Rex, Triceratops and Stegosaurus, since it was done before the new compression method was implemented. But that's Microsoft for ya.
Were or weren't able to extract those?![]()
Tyrannosaurus Rex, Triceratops, Styracosaurus and Carnotaurus were all extracted by the ZT2 modders. I however do not have those models since I never bought that bonus pack since those eventually got added to the Extinct Animals XP (in compressed form).
